Retaining Walls

walls retaining serviceRetaining walls are carefully engineered systems that are capable of holding back tons of saturated soil and preventing soil erosion, which can cause foundation damage or damage to surrounding landscapes. A retaining wall can also be used to increase usable yard space by terracing sloped property. They can be designed to increase the aesthetic appeal of a landscape, and low retaining walls can add a natural bench or seating area.

The cost of retaining walls:

Retaining wall cost varies depending on the size, material used, and the design. However, don’t let cost be the only deciding factor. Material quality and workmanship are critical. The structural integrity of your concrete retaining wall is crucial to safety and durability. Sub-standard design, materials and construction could mean unnecessary repair expenses, or worse, having to redo it entirely.

Types of retaining walls:

1. Timber Retaining Walls: These types of walls are affordable and that can be used for low- to mid-height wall construction projects. They complement contemporary and rustic looks.

2. Interlocking Block Retaining Walls: These types of retaining walls use one of several interlocking block systems, which are generally made of concrete or cement. They are aesthetically appealing and can be found in a variety of shapes, textures, and colors to fit any style. It is durable and can be used for small or large walls up to 20 feet high.

Natural Stone Retaining Walls: These types of walls can be constructed using stone, brick, or cinder block. They can be stacked, non-mortared stones or mortared stones. Stone retaining walls can create a rustic look while brick retaining walls offers a more formal style. These walls typically are extremely effective in holding against soil erosion.

4. Concrete Retaining Walls: These types of walls are typically very strong and durable. They can be used effectively for small or large projects. While bare concrete is not particularly appealing, concrete retaining walls can be covered with a stone veneer or special forms can be used to improve their look.
